Table 3 Different collection and preparation conditions between the two studies

From: Tyrosine phosphorylation of band 3 impairs the storage quality of suspended red blood cells in the Tibetan high-altitude polycythemia population

 

Pervious 2015 study [8]

This study

Collection locality

Lhasa

Chengdu

Preparation time of SRBCs

One week after whole-blood collection

Within 6 h of whole-blood collection

Population

Han Chinese who migrated to the Tibetan plateau for more than 1 year

Local Tibetan volunteers, resident of Tibet (> 3600 m) for more than 10 years, and blood was collected within 30 days of leaving the Tibetan Plateau

Grouping

No further grouping was performed in high altitude population

Volunteers were divided into the high-altitude control (HAC) group (120 g/L < males ≤ 185 g/L, 115 g/L < females ≤ 165 g/L) and the HAPC group (males ≥ 210 g/L, females ≥ 190 g/L)
